As for the T8 or T12 bulb replacement you disconnect the ballast and hook it to power on most and thats it.

Here is a direct replacement with NO wiring changes

4 ft. 20-Watt T12 40W Equivalent Daylight (5000K) G13 Plug and Play Linear LED Tube Light Bulb (10-Pack)

https://www.homedepot.com/p/Feit-Electric-4-ft-20-Watt-T12-40W-Equivalent-Daylight-5000K-G13-Plug-and-Play-Linear-LED-Tube-Light-Bulb-10-Pack-T1248-850-LEDG2-2-5/311128416

I picked up new LED shop light fixtures for about $30 each at Menards. It was cheaper to replace the entire fixture than buying the replacement bulbs. These are daylight, 4 ft, 2 bulb style with plug and pull switch even though mine are direct wire on a wall switch. I just replaced the cover plate on the electrical ceiling box and cut the plug off to wire them up. I suppose I could have just added outlets to the ceiling boxes but....These are similar to the fixtures I used https://www.menards.com/main/lighting-ceiling-fans/commercial-lights/smart-electrician-reg-5000-lumens-46-x-6-led-tread-plate-shop-light/pes120led-st1-s-4800/p-1493360352403.htm. The "blue light" in LED lighting can damage the eye's retina and disturb natural sleep rhythms, France's government-run health watchdog said this week.

New findings confirm earlier concerns that "exposure to an intense and powerful [LED] light is 'photo-toxic' and can lead to irreversible loss of retinal cells and diminished sharpness of vision," the French Agency for Food, Environmental and Occupational Health & Safety (ANSES) warned in a statement.

The agency recommended in a 400-page report that the maximum limit for acute exposure be revised, even if such levels are rarely met in home or work environments.

The report distinguished between acute exposure of high-intensity LED light, and "chronic exposure" to lower intensity sources.

Led lighting is variable by color temperature. 2600 Kelvin is the same as soft white incandescent bulbs, 3000 Kelvin will be daylight incandescent, 4000 Kelvin will be still mostly white starting into the blue spectrum, 5000 Kelvin is ice blue and 6000 Kelvin is blue. A shop light to eliminate shadows should be in the 3000-4000 Kelvin range. I replaced my 4' tubes with the ballast delete style. Removed ballast and rewired. There is a type available that is plug and play using the original ballast, but the buzzing from the ballast is what I wanted to eliminate. Love them, instant on and no flickering or noise.  cooldude
